Output 23804ccb22f8f90a958382ad938bdd3e4522eb947f854b4bdde52ddbc28051ee:0

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 381e8118986fa23d551c2be4a45dbf90058a2ec8 OP_EQUAL
address
36okJm5ucRMYeUmwUtYaynSeCoMdbKgT6u
transaction
23804ccb22f8f90a958382ad938bdd3e4522eb947f854b4bdde52ddbc28051ee
confirmations
360212
spent
true